6/* Purpose of this file is to share functionality to allowlist or denylist
7 * opcodes used in PF <-> VF communication. Group of opcodes:
8 * - default -> should be always allowed after creating VF,
9 *   default_allowlist_opcodes
10 * - opcodes needed by VF to work correctly, but not associated with caps ->
11 *   should be allowed after successful VF resources allocation,
12 *   working_allowlist_opcodes
13 * - opcodes needed by VF when caps are activated
14 *
15 * Caps that don't use new opcodes (no opcodes should be allowed):
16 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_WB_ON_ITR
17 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_CRC
18 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_RX_POLLING
19 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_RSS_PCTYPE_V2
20 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_ENCAP
21 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_ENCAP_CSUM
22 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_RX_ENCAP_CSUM
23 * - VIRTCHNL_VF_OFFLOAD_USO
24 */
